The overview below groups typical Sidewalk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Auburn Hills,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per Square Foot Costs - Sidewalk leveling services typically range from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the extent of the unevenness and the area size. For example, leveling a 50-square-foot section might cost between $150 and $400.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.

Flat Rate Pricing - Some providers offer flat rates for sidewalk leveling projects, which can vary from $200 to $600 for standard-sized sections. Larger or more complex areas may incur higher costs, with prices reaching up to $1,000 or more. Contact local service providers for tailored quotes.

Cost for Concrete Raising - Concrete raising or mudjacking to level sidewalks generally costs between $2 and $6 per square foot. A typical 100-square-foot area might be priced around $200 to $600. Prices depend on the severity of the unevenness and local market rates.

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on factors such as the sidewalk's condition, accessibility, and the need for additional repairs. Extra services like crack filling or surface replacement may increase overall expenses. Local contractors can offer detailed cost assessments for specific projects.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es sidewalks to become uneven? Sidewalks can become uneven due to soil erosion, tree root growth, freeze-thaw cycles, or poor initial installation.

How can sidewalk unevenness be fixed? Local service providers typically use leveling or mudjacking techniques to restore a smooth, even surface.

Is sidewalk leveling a temporary solution? Properly performed leveling can provide a long-lasting fix, but ongoing ground movement or tree growth may require future maintenance.

How long does sidewalk leveling usually take? The duration depends on the extent of the unevenness and the chosen method, with many projects completing within a day or two.
